Abstract

Vinyl acetate has been polymerized by bulk process with and without different types
of amines compunds as chain transfer agents. The various chain transfer constants(Cs) and
their temperature dependence over a range of temperatures of (65–85°C) have been
determined and discussed.
The chain transfer constants of propylamine, dipropylamine and N-ethylaniline were
evaluated by using May plot, their values found as follows:
N – ethyl aniline > dipropyl amine > propyl amine
The high values of chain transfer constants of N-ethyl aniline were attributed to the resonance
stability of the radical derived after the transfer process.
Activation energies of the chain transfer processes in the present polymerization systems were
also determined using the usual Arrhenius relationship, which were found inconsistent with
the values of chain transfer constants.
